If yesterday’s temperature was any sign: summer is finally in sight, and if you’re fortunate enough to have a pool at home, it’s time to start thinking about opening and preparing it for the season. Here are six tips to ensure your pool is in top shape before making a splash.

  1. Clean and store your pool cover properly. After a Canadian winter of snow, wind, and rain, your pool cover has likely collected water and dirt. To prevent it from ending up in the pool, use a small pump to remove the water and try a skimmer or rake to collect debris. Then, give the cover a good clean and rinse before storing it safely for next season.
  2. Do a thorough clean up, inside and out. Make sure the area around the pool—like the surrounding deck and patio—is clear of any dirt or debris that could end up in the pool once the cover is removed. Have a lawn or garden nearby? Collect any loose grass or weeds, too. After, remove any debris inside the pool with a skimmer and clean thoroughly with a pool brush. Use the pool vacuum to pick up dirt at the bottom.
  3. Check for any damage. While giving the pool a clean, keep an eye out for any wear and tear that may have occurred over the winter. This includes making sure all equipment is running properly, and examining the lining for any leaks that need to be repaired.
  4. Stock up on the right chemicals. Check that you have all the necessary chemicals for your pool before you begin the opening process. The amount and combination you need can vary depending on the type of pool, but your checklist should generally include chlorine, shock treatment, algaecide, and testing strips.
  5. Examine and install accessories. Inspect pool accessories like ladders and the diving board to see if they’re still in good shape and ready for the summer.
  6. Do a safety check. A new season means evaluating pool safety, including testing gate latches and locks, looking for fence gaps, keeping flotation and safety devices accessible, using safety drain covers, and storing chemicals out of reach.
